The Google Pixel 3 XL is a bit better than the Google Nexus 5, with an 80.7 score against 76. The Google Pixel 3 XL body is extremely newer and a little thinner, but noticeably heavier than Google Nexus 5. The Google Pixel 3 XL has a little better performance than Google Nexus 5, because although it has doesn't have a graphics processor, it also counts with a larger amount of RAM and more cores.
Google Nexus 5 counts with a slightly better looking screen than Google Pixel 3 XL, although it has a much smaller display, a lot worse 1920 x 1080px resolution and a little bit less pixels per screen inch. The Google Pixel 3 XL has a lot bigger storage capacity for games and applications than Google Nexus 5, because it has more internal storage.
Google Pixel 3 XL has a superior camera than Google Nexus 5, because it has a lot higher (4K) video resolution, a much bigger diafragm aperture for better low light photos, a lot larger back camera sensor taking way better quality photographs and a back camera with way more MP. Google Pixel 3 XL counts with a much better battery duration than Google Nexus 5, because it has a 49% bigger battery capacity.
